PLAYS BY MILBURN DAVIS
Milburn Davis, award-winning playwright and multi-genre writer, is making available his plays for production by colleges, universities and regional theatres throughout America and abroad.

"Sometimes a Switchblade Helps" was produced at City College in New York City. "The $100,000 Nigger" or "The $100,000 Jackass" (if you are sensitive about using the 'n' word) was produced at Spelman College in Atlanta, GA after winning a contest for Best One Act Play.

"Galivantin' Husband" was produced at the St. Marks Theatre in Greenwich Village in the Negro Ensemble Company's Studio facility.

Milburn Davis' plays have been enjoyed across America. He honed his craft with the famed Negro Ensemble Company, where he was a member of the playwrighting and acting workshops.
